[JS] firstChild.nodeValue nie chce usuwać zawartości obiektu

0

Tworzę sobie zawartość elementu dynamicznie:

[...]
<script type="text/javascript">
function $(obj) { return document.getElementById(obj); }
function add() {
  $('divek').appendChild( document.createTextNode( "teks w środku DIV" ) );
}
function remove() {
  $('divek').firstChild.nodeValue = "";
}
</script>
</head>
<body>
  <div id="divek"> </div>

i funkcja add() poprawnie dodaje tekst ale już remove() nie chce go usuwać i nie wywala żadnego błędu... Dlaczego ?

0

nodeValue.
Ale lepiej kasować cały węzeł.

$('divek').removeChild($('divek').firstChild);
0

<div id="divek"> </div>

wstawiles spacje do diva i ta spacja to jest wlasnie firstChild :-)
[dopisane]
oczywiscie pod IE jest inaczej i dziala dobrze...

1 użytkowników online, w tym zalogowanych: 0, gości: 1